Fang Yusheng and the rest heard these words and their lips twitched.
He was even lonely!
Fang Zicheng really could not stand it anymore. In order to make his brother shut up, he had no choice but to use his trump card. "My wound hurts."
Fang Zikai fell silent.
His brother said that his wound was painful. At the thought that his brother was injured because he was playful, Fang Zikai was too embarrassed to continue talking. "I'm sorry." After he apologized, he suddenly shut his mouth and let go of his brother. He retreated and only looked at him from afar.
!!
The ward instantly fell silent.
Qiao Jiusheng carried Fang Taoran from Lisa's arms. She hugged her sister vertically and let her back lean on her chest. Qiao Jiusheng dragged her sister's butt with one hand and wrapped her other hand around her sister's chest. This made it easier for Fang Taoran to size up her brother.
The baby changed drastically every day. Fang Taoran, who was more than three months old, had big, black eyes that were filled with vigor like two black grapes. Her skin was especially fair, the pinkish white. She was very good-looking, and her cheeks were chubby.
Fang Taoran stared at this big brother and smiled until her eyes curved.
Seeing his sister suddenly smile at him, Fang Zicheng was stunned for a moment before smiling faintly at her. Seeing his brother smile, Fang Taoran started to smile again. Fang Zikai watched from the side and felt a little jealous.
He stood up from behind Qiao Jiusheng and stood beside Fang Taoran.
Fang Zikai also smiled at Fang Zicheng. His smile was sly. Fang Zicheng glanced at his brother, chose to ignore him, and looked at his sister.
Fang Zikai was instantly unhappy. "Look at me. Why are you always staring at Ran Ran?" Fang Zikai quickly declared, "I know how to smile too. Brother, I'll smile for you."

Fang Zicheng quickly shifted his gaze away from his sister, afraid that his brother would be jealous and smile at him for a long time.
Qiao Jiusheng picked up Fang Taoran's right hand and placed it on Fang Zicheng's face.
Fang Zicheng did not dare to move anymore, as if he was afraid of disturbing his sister.
Qiao Jiusheng said to Fang Taoran, "Ran Ran, tell Brother to rest well and cooperate with the doctor's treatment. Try to be discharged as soon as possible and play with Ran Ran and Little Brother when you get home, okay?"
Fang Taoran could not understand what Qiao Jiusheng was muttering about. She stopped laughing and opened her eyes to look at Fang Zicheng, her legs glaring wildly.
Qiao Jiusheng said these words because she wanted Fang Zicheng to say them.
Fang Zicheng's gaze landed on Qiao Jiusheng's face.
In just a few days, Qiao Jiusheng seemed to have lost some weight. She, who used to clamor about losing weight, had really successfully lost weight these few days. Fang Zicheng nodded and said to Qiao Jiusheng, "I will, Mom."
Qiao Jiusheng's heart skipped a beat.
She felt extremely relieved and happy to hear Fang Zicheng call her mother again. Qiao Jiusheng bent down and placed her head on Fang Zicheng's face. She said softly, "Cheng Cheng, you're back. It's great."
Fang Zicheng was still not used to hearing his mother call him Cheng Cheng. His mother always liked to call him Iron Egg. Suddenly, she became serious and emotional. Fang Zicheng felt uncomfortable everywhere.
Fang Zicheng heard Qiao Jiusheng crying.
His expression was calm, and he could not feel his mother's emotions.
Fang Yusheng also walked over and held Fang Zicheng's hand. He said, "I'm sorry, Cheng Cheng. Dad was useless and caused you to be injured."
Fang Zicheng shook his head.
After thinking about it, he said, "It's not your fault." He had never blamed Qiao Jiusheng and Fang Yusheng. He was already prepared to die and was lucky to be saved. Fang Zicheng would not blame anyone.

On the contrary, he was grateful.
When Qiao Jiusheng stood up and Fang Yusheng hugged her waist, the group of people in the house calmed down. Fang Zicheng then said, "In the past, I always felt that there was no point in living."
He really felt that way.
He could not understand feelings. Living was like nothing to him. Just like how people had to drink water every day, orange juice became a seasoning. Nothing would happen if you drank orange juice.
To Fang Zicheng, living was the cup of orange juice. It could be there or not.
However, when he was really about to die, the face of his family flashed across Fang Zicheng's mind. He did not understand that it was reluctance and love. He just did not want to die. At the thought that if he died, he would never see his family again, and his family would become depressed because of his death, Fang Zicheng urgently wanted to live.
Live on and watch your parents grow old happily every day.
She lived and watched the annoying Fang Zikai grow up crying.
He would live on and grow up with his cute little sister. When she got a boyfriend in the future, he would be there for her.
He still had so many things he could do. He had to live. Only by living could he see his family happy and watch his sister grow up. Fang Zicheng said again, "But from now on, every day, I will live with a grateful heart. In the future, I will never treat living as a casual thing again. Living is a very sacred and precious thing. I will cherish every day I live and cherish everyone around me."
It was not surprising for an adult to say this. However, everyone was shocked to hear such an infectious sentence from a four-year-old child.
Fang Yusheng looked at Fang Zicheng and suddenly smiled.
"Okay! That's it!" He was proud of him.
Fang Zicheng saw the joy in his family's eyes and thought: Oh, so it's also something that makes his family happy that he's willing to live well. Then he has to live well in the future.
...
Fang Ping and Liu Yu left China half a month later.
On the day he left, he did not disturb anyone. The family of three brought their luggage and passports and quietly went to the airport. On the way to the airport, Fang Pingjun stared at the scenery outside the window with teary eyes. The things that had once seemed calm to him were now extremely cute and intimate.
At the thought that he was about to leave his hometown and could never return, Fang Pingjun felt troubled. For a moment, he actually wanted to cry. Liu Yu and Fang Yupei did not comfort him because they were also feeling terrible.
When they lived in this country and on this soil, they were always complaining about all kinds of bad things in this country. They scolded the country for being corrupt, the people for being rude, and the food for being unhealthy.
However, they felt reluctant to leave when they were really far away from this yellow soil.
The feeling of parting lingered in their hearts.
The car was very quiet. No one spoke.
They arrived at the airport. When they entered the terminal, Fang Pingjun suddenly said, "Take a photo!"
Liu Yu and Fang Yupei stopped in their tracks at the same time.
The three of them turned around and stared at the sky above Binjiang City. Due to the air pollution, the sky could not be found with blue sky and white clouds. It looked gray. Liu Yu nodded with tears in her eyes and said, "Okay."
